Every Photoroom plan includes a set amount of exports for use with Batch. The pool of exports is shared across a Space.
In this article, we’ll explain how the Batch export count works and what is included with each plan. We also answer some common questions and explain how to track usage.
How Batch export count works
Each Space has a limited number of Batch exports per month/week. Whenever you or someone in your Space uses Batch to export images, it counts towards this limit.
You are granted a total number of images you can export using Batch.
You can edit up to 250 images per batch across all platforms.
Export quotas are reset monthly (or weekly for weekly plans).
Note: If you use AI features in Batch edits, they cost AI credits. These are automatically deducted from your Space’s AI credits.
What is the Batch export limit for each plan?
This table shows the Batch export limits for each plan.
Plan duration | Limit reset | Free | Pro | Max | Ultra | Ultra | Ultra | Ultra |
Weekly | Weekly | 0 | 125 | 400 | N/A |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Monthly | Monthly | 0 | 500 | 1,500 | 5,000 | 10,000 | 25,000 | 50,000 |
Yearly | Monthly | 0 | 500 | 1,500 | 5,000 | 10,000 | 25,000 | 50,000 |
Important: Units are counted per image, not per batch. 1 unit = 1 image processed. For example, if a batch contains 10 images, processing that batch will use 10 units.

When do limits reset?

Free users: limits don't reset
Weekly subscribers: limits reset every week on renewal date.
Monthly and Yearly users: limits reset every month on the date of the subscription. If you subscribed on July 15th, limits will reset on the 15th of every month.
As a Batch user, will I also use AI credits?

If you use AI features inside Batch, each generation will use AI credits.
If you only use Batch to remove backgrounds or edit manually, you will not use AI credits.
This separation keeps things transparent: you only use AI credits when you’re actually generating new content with AI.
